Keanu Evans, a man involved in a disturbing altercation on a Frontier Airlines flight, is sharing his harrowing experience, which he claims drastically transformed his life in an instant. The incident, which took place on July 1, 2025, was recorded from various angles by fellow travelers, with edited clips subsequently dominating news feeds. However, Evans argues that these initial reports are misleading, as he continues to endure a wave of racist backlash, despite authorities deeming the attack “unprovoked.” Evans described the confrontation's build-up after being prompted by loud, mocking laughter from Ishaan Sharma, a 21-year-old from New Jersey, before being assaulted. After alerting flight attendants, he returned to confront Sharma. “The only thing that distresses me is the continuous spreading of false narratives,” Evans remarked, noting public criticism. Sharma now faces charges and a $500 bond after the incident that echoed broader concerns over escalating in-flight violence, underscoring the need for increased passenger safety measures.
